Book Reviews of Ten Little LadybugsBook Review: O.k. book Summary: 3 StarsThis book is great for kids. But as an adult I have the ability to compare it with other books like this. For example "10 little Butterflies". 10 Little Butterflies is much better. The rhymes in "Ladybugs" are stunted, lacking rhythm frequently. But then again, my kid can't read. Illustrations are good and my kid likes to play with the little bugs and holes in pages.
Buy it, it's fine for your child. But you, me and Melanie Gerth know she didn't bring her "A" game to this one....
